Finally completed (thank you, Hasbro, for bringing me Duke's head on a Renegades platter)! ;)
For fans of Hama's classic comic series--as well as Uber-Fans of Snake Eyes (even the haters might appreciate this one), I bring you... Snake Eyes from issue #104! This is the SE version that was under the Arishakage mindset trance--placed by Storm Shadow--to get his mind off of Scarlett, who was in a coma and apparently succumbing to death. Storm Shadow sent him on a dangerous mission to rescue his sister's former fiance, George Strawhacker, a U.S. spy, who has been captured in Borovian gulag, left to rot by the "Jugglers." This version shows SE with his face revealed--complete with 2 scars, remains of his once destroyed face, now surgically repaired--as well as a tan trenchcoat. He also comes with the George Strawhacker file that he recovered in Borovia, as well as his briefcase that contains another broken-down weapon, ready to go. To complete this figure, I used: The 25th anniversary figure of the original V3--the one with the removable chest knives. I removed the SE head and the arms. I replaced the arms with the arms of the movie version of Cobra Commander, as well as the trenchcoat. After carving off the silver molded weapon on the arms, I added the lines/cordoroy look to the sleeves, and painted them--along with the trenchcoat--a tan color to match the comic art. After taking apart the figure and putting the arms and trenchcoat on, I turned to the briefcase, where I cut apart a similar looking weapon and added it to the inside case, along with the rounds of ammo that he later dons in issue #105. Next, I found a pic of someone in chains on the web, and shrunk the pic down and added the written summary that was found in the file in the comic. Once I had this done, I made a mini file folder, and the Strawhacker file was complete! Finally, I waited and was rewarded with the ultimate head...Renegade Duke! This head is perfectly sculpted with eyes that stare right through you and a you-don't-want-to-mess-with-me demeanor...perfect for SE. After carving the two scars into his face with an exacto blade, I very carefully used a pin and applied a pinkish hue to his scars. YES!!!!!
